Arduino powered tank with a custom controller that I made over the past year. It's partially waterproof and uses one arduino mega in the tank and a nano for the turret by RealJopeYT in arduino

[–]RealJopeYT[S] 1 point2 points  (0 children)

I'm not sure but it uses a NRF24L01+ with an antenna which theoretically has up to 1km range
When it comes to battery I was using a 4s 2700mAh battery and after driving it for ~1 hour it used about half of it
